In May 1997, Olive ViewUCLA Medical Center became a part of ValleyCare, which maintains responsibility for the care of the medically indigent, low income, uninsured residents of the San Fernando and Santa Clarita Valleys. The Office of Graduate Medical Education (GME) Olive View-UCLA Medical Center is a major affiliate of the David Geffen School of Medicine at UCLA.
